it is a reference card
That is the reason why, it will not fit on a card with a stacked power socket

do you think they will build a work aroud
Not for the extreme3, it fits the non reference 680s that dont have the stacked socket, but unless you get a shorter cooler or if they make a special 680 one i doubt it.

i emailed company to make sure and the Accelero Hybrid and Accelero Twin Turbo II
fit reference series gtx 680's thanks for the link
